What has been proposed is a delay of the payment deadline if you owe a payment, but not a delay of the filing deadline.  (But nothing is official yet.)

 

Second, you should expect that if the IRS changes the payment deadline, it will take at least 2 weeks to program the change into Turbotax and release a new update.  

 

What you can do now is select in Turbotax, "I will pay by mail."  Then whenever you are ready, mail a check or make a direct payment at the IRS web site irs.gov/payments.  You can pay be direct debit from your bank account for free, or use a credit card and pay a service charge.  It would be your responsibility to pay "on time", whatever that turns out to be.

There is no way in Turbotax to change the date once you have transmitted your return. 

 

The IRS has a phone number to cancel or change payment dates, assuming that someone answers.

https://www.irs.gov/payments/pay-taxes-by-electronic-funds-withdrawal

 

You could also ask your bank to block the withdrawal, and then mail a check or make a payment on the IRS web site before the new deadline.  But the IRS will charge you a "bounced check fee" if they try to make an electronic withdrawal and it is blocked. 

 

 

Get your taxes done using TurboTax

  • Once your return is accepted, information pertaining to your payment, such as account information, payment date, or amount, cannot be changed. If changes are needed, the only option is to cancel the payment and choose another payment method.
  • Call IRS e-file Payment Services 24/7 at 1-888-353-4537 to inquire about or cancel your payment, but please wait 7 to 10 days after your return was accepted before calling.
  • Cancellation requests must be received no later than 11:59 p.m. ET two business days prior to the scheduled payment date.
